Conversion formula
The conversion factor from cubic feet to deciliters is 283.168467117, which means that 1 cubic foot is equal to 283.168467117 deciliters:
1 ft3 = 283.168467117 dL
To convert 8295 cubic feet into deciliters we have to multiply 8295 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from cubic feet to deciliters.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 ft3 → 283.168467117 dL
8295 ft3 → V(dL)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in deciliters:
V(dL) = 8295 ft3 × 283.168467117 dL
V(dL) = 2348882.4347355 dL
The final result is:
8295 ft3 → 2348882.4347355 dL
We conclude that 8295 cubic feet is equivalent to 2348882.4347355 deciliters:
8295 cubic feet = 2348882.4347355 deciliters
